Recognizing Addiction as a Chronic Disease
Dependency is not concerning making negative choices; it is an intricate mind problem. The American Medical Association (AMA) and the National Institute on Drug Abuse (NIDA) specify dependency as a persistent, relapsing illness that changes mind chemistry. When a person continuously utilizes compounds, it impacts the brain's reward system, making it significantly hard to quit.
Much like conditions such as diabetic issues or hypertension, addiction calls for correct administration and treatment. The brain undertakes long-term modifications, especially in areas in charge of judgment, decision-making, and impulse control. This is why stopping on sheer willpower alone is often not successful. Medical treatments, treatment, and support systems are necessary to take care of the disease effectively.
The Science Behind Addiction and Brain Changes
Substance usage hijacks the mind's typical functions, causing compulsive actions and dependency. Alcohol and drugs flood the mind with dopamine, a neurotransmitter in charge of feelings of satisfaction and incentive. In time, the mind adapts, requiring even more of the material to accomplish the very same effect. This is referred to as resistance, and it typically leads to raised consumption, withdrawal signs, and a cycle of dependence.
Brain imaging research studies have actually revealed that addiction impacts the prefrontal cortex, the part of the mind responsible for logical decision-making. This clarifies why people having problem with substance usage often continue their habits regardless of adverse repercussions. They are not choosing dependency; their minds have actually been re-shaped to focus on materials over everything else.
Why Stigma Prevents People from Seeking Help
Regardless of the frustrating clinical proof, preconception continues to be among the biggest obstacles to recuperation. Many people hesitate to seek drug treatment because they fear judgment from household, good friends, or culture. This embarassment and seclusion can make dependency even worse, pressing people deeper right into material usage.
Preconception additionally influences public laws and medical care techniques. Rather than checking out addiction as a medical issue, numerous still treat it as a criminal or moral failing. This approach leads to poor financing for therapy programs, restricted access to methadone treatment, and societal being rejected of harm-reduction methods. If we wish to enhance healing outcomes, we should shift our perspective and welcome evidence-based remedies.
The Role of Medication-Assisted Treatment (MAT)
One of one of the most efficient ways to manage dependency is with Medication-Assisted Treatment (MAT). MAT combines drugs with therapy and behavior modifications to offer an all natural technique to healing. For people with opioid usage disorder, methadone maintenance treatment can be a game-changer.
Methadone is a long-acting opioid agonist that helps reduce desires and withdrawal signs. Unlike illicit opioids, it does not generate the exact same euphoric impacts, allowing people to support their lives and concentrate on healing. Getting Rid Of Myths About Addiction Treatment
There are many misconceptions surrounding dependency treatment, especially when it comes to medication-assisted techniques. Some think that using methadone or other drugs simply replaces one dependency with an additional. This is far from the reality.
Methadone and comparable drugs are thoroughly controlled and recommended under clinical guidance. They function by normalizing brain chemistry and minimizing the frustrating impulse to use opioids. Unlike neglected addiction, MAT enables people to operate normally, hold jobs, and rebuild their lives. Education is key in taking apart myths and encouraging people to seek proper treatment.
